U2U from Ghost Raven to Springer:
from: GhostRaven
sent: 6-26-2007 at 10:28 PM
Springer,
This was a completely fabricated story. I am not just some jerk who wanted to waste everyone's time, however. I actually was -- as I hinted in my first few posts -- studying how internet hoaxes get started. In fact, I thought that I had left more than enough hints in those posts for everyone who has been around for a long time to figure out what I was doing. In other words, I did not intend to be a malicious liar. Heck, I even picked a storyline that would be patently absurd.
At every stage in this tale I intended to write up an ending 'summary' that would state what I learned/noticed during the hoaxing. My idea was to be a 'friendly' hoaxer who could point out holes in the system... while trying to entertain everyone.
I decided to deliberately dive the thread into the ground, however, when people started talking about hunting me down, having the police arrest me, or going off into the woods. If I really was a horrible jerk I could have easily kept the community spinning for weeks. In fact, I had material written up that would have won a lot of people over. When I decided to end it, however, I decided to do it in a way that would allow everyone to watch what happens to a thread even after it has been debunked. Again, even in the end, I was experimenting.
Was this a bad thing? Not if you think practice makes perfect.
At any rate, I'd be willing to post a reply on the thread that will show how I constructed the hoax, how I altered it, and what I was looking for tomorrow (if you'd like). As much as some people may hate me... keep in mind that, unlike certain other big hoaxes, I did kamikaze it and I am willing to explain it.
Anyways, have a nice night and feel free to copy this message to the thread.
